ARTIFACT: Rare mid 1930's New Hampshire Motor Vehicle Department Inspector badge by Whitehead & Hoag, New Jersey. The center of the badge shows the NH State Seal and surrounding it reads: "INSPECTOR NEW HAMPSHIRE MOTOR VEHICLE DEPT.", the base of the badge shows the number "64", and the top features an eagle, wings spread and head bowed. This badge was woirn by NH State Motor Vehicle Inspectors, who served in a capacity similar to the NH State Police, prior to that agency's formation in 1938. Overall, the badge shows great detail and the reverse features a great Whitehead & Hoag maker's plaque.
